מיקרוסופט מוצאת דרך לפתור את בעיית Pinch-Zoom של Chromium במכשירי Windows 10

סמל זמן קריאה 2 דקות לקרוא


קוראים עוזרים לתמוך ב-MSpoweruser. אנו עשויים לקבל עמלה אם תקנה דרך הקישורים שלנו. סמל טיפים

קרא את דף הגילויים שלנו כדי לגלות כיצד תוכל לעזור ל-MSPoweruser לקיים את צוות העריכה קראו עוד

כעת, כשמיקרוסופט היא כעת שחקן צוות בפיתוח Chromium, תכונות ותיקונים חדשים צפויים להגיע בתדירות גבוהה יותר בכל הדפדפנים המבוססים על Chromium בקוד פתוח. גלילה חלקה היא אחת התרומות הראויות לציון שמיקרוסופט תרמה לדפדפנים מבוססי Chromium כגון Microsoft Edge החדש, Google Chrome, Opera וכו'.

כעת החברה רוצה לתקן בעיה מוזרה נוספת ב-Chromium. מיקרוסופט החלה לעבוד על תיקון לבעיית ה-Punch-Zoom של Chromium. לפי א פוסט באג, משתמשים לא יכולים למנוע תנועת צביטה זום במכשירי Windows 10(דרך Windows האחרון). ניתן לשחזר את הבאג גם במחשבי Mac. עם זאת, מכשירי Windows 10 כגון Surface Book ו- Surface Pro מועדים לבעיה.

"קשה להתרבות בכוונה. במהלך העבודה, באג מתרחש 5 פעמים ביום. כמו כן, השגיאה אינה משוכפלת בכל מחשב. אני מתמודד עם זה ב-MacBook 2016 ו MacBook Pro 2018 13 אינץ' ללא מגע בר. לפי הרגשות הסובייקטיביים שלי, קל יותר לשחזר ב-Surface Book Pro", הסביר מהנדס של מיקרוסופט.

לפי כותב פוסט הבאג, משתמשים מושפעים מהבאג רק כאשר הם מנסים אחת מהפעילויות הבאות:

  • מקם את הסמן מעל הגלילה "מניעה אמיתית של מטפל ברירת מחדל".
  • בצע הטלת לוח מגע מהירה (שים לב, הגלילה לא ממש גוללה).
  • בצע מיד תנועת צביטה-זום.

כעת, על פי התחייבות שבוצעה לאחרונה על ידי מפתחי Microsoft Edge, נראה כי תיקון לבעיית ה-Pitch-Zoom נמצא בעיצומו.

"בשני תרחישים שונים: או המעבר מגלילה->צביטה, או מ-fling->צביטה. בשני המקרים, אירועים תוארו בתור ב-TouchpadPinchEventQueue, ואז TouchpadPinchEventQueue::ProcessMouseWheelAck קיבלה ACKs, ש-TPEQ הניח שהם ה-ACKs לאירועים שכבר עמדו בתור."

"למרות שזה נכון לעתים קרובות, זה לא תמיד היה כך. לפעמים, ה-ACKs של אירועי הגלילה או הפלינג היו מגיעים לאחר שאירועי ה-pinch כבר הועמדו בתור, ובמקרה זה ה-ACKs יעובדו כאילו היו לאירועי צביטה כשהם לא היו."

בהתחייבות אחרת, מיקרוסופט ציינה כי "עכשיו עם השינוי הזה, אם אנחנו עוברים מגלילה לקמצוץ, המומנטום_phase של אירוע מוגדר לחסום, מה שמסמן שגלילת מומנטום לא תתרחש. לאחר מכן אנו שולחים מיד את אירוע הסיום מבלי לחכות".

אתה יכול לצפות שהתיקון יגיע בעדכוני Chromium העתידיים.

עוד על הנושאים: דפדפן, כרום, צביטה-זום, משטח, מכשירי Windows 10

השאירו תגובה

כתובת הדוא"ל שלך לא תפורסם. שדות חובה מסומנים *